Appropriate Preposition:

  • Plead for ( ওকালতি করা (কোনকিছু) ) I pleaded with him for justice (against the wrong done to me).
  • Object to ( আপত্তি করা ) He objected to my proposal.
  • Smile on ( অনুগ্রহ করা ) Fortune smiled on him.
  • Delight in ( আনন্দ ) He takes delight in music.
  • Wonder at ( অবাক হওয়া ) I wonder at his ignorance.
  • Superior to ( উৎকৃষ্টতর ) This type of rice is superior to that.

Idioms:

  • ABC ( প্রাথমিক জ্ঞান ) Everybody must know at least the ABC of religion.
  • Take to one's heels ( ছুটিয়া পালানো ) The thieves took to their heels to see the police.
  • Die in harness ( কর্মরত অবস্থায় মারা যাওয়া ) Dr. Sen died in harness.
  • Out of temper ( ক্রুদ্ধ ) He is out of temper now.
  • In cold blood ( ঠান্ডা মাথায় ) They committed this murder in cold blood.
  • a rotten apple ( কোনো একটা দলের সব ভালোর মধ্যে খারাপ বা মন্দটা ) In any group of average citizens there are bound to be a few rotten apples.
